คำถามติดแท็ก terminfo

1
ฉันจะส่งคีย์ฟังก์ชั่นไปที่ htop ได้ด้วยวิธีใด?
ฉันพยายามที่จะใช้htopใน tty1 อย่างไรก็ตามปุ่มฟังก์ชั่นบางปุ่มไม่ทำงานตามปกติ F1และF2ไม่ทำอะไรเลยและF3ดูเหมือนว่าจะก่อให้เกิดการติดตั้ง (ซึ่งโดยปกติจะถูกเรียกโดยF2) นอกจากนี้F4และF5ไม่ทำงาน นอกจากนี้เมื่อฉันลองและกดEscเพื่อออกจากหน้าจอเหล่านี้ฉันต้องกดสองครั้ง ในเทอร์มินัลปกติ ( terminator) ปุ่มฟังก์ชันจะทำงานได้ดี อย่างไรก็ตามฉันต้องกดEscสองครั้งที่นี่ด้วยดังนั้นอาจเป็นปลาเฮอริ่งแดง ฉันจะใช้ปุ่มฟังก์ชั่นเหล่านี้ใน tty1 ได้อย่างไร? แก้ไข ใน tty1 ถ้าฉันกดCtrl+ vจากนั้นF1ไปที่F5ฯลฯ ฉันจะได้ผลลัพธ์ต่อไปนี้: ^[[[A ^[[[B ^[[[C ^[[[D ^[[[E ในterminatorฉันได้รับ ^[OP ^[OQ ^[OR ^[OS ^[[15~ ปุ่มฟังก์ชั่นด้านบนนี้เทียบเท่า (เช่น^[[17~สำหรับF6) แก้ไข 2 ในการตอบสนองStéphane Chazelas ของความคิดเห็น $TERMเหมือนกันใน tty1 เหมือนกับใน "terminal" ปกติของฉัน xterm-256colorมันเป็น ฉันไม่ได้ใช้หน้าจอหรือ tmux ผมใช้htop1.0.3 htopแม้ว่าการแก้ไขครั้งแรกของฉันดูเหมือนจะชี้ไปที่มันเป็นปัญหาของต้นน้ำ " …
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.